设置服务器时间命令是什么
-
设置服务器时间的命令可以根据不同操作系统的不同,以下是几种常见的设置服务器时间的命令:
-
Windows操作系统:
- 使用命令行设置服务器时间:在命令提示符窗口中输入"date"命令可以查看当前日期和时间,输入"date [日期] [时间]"命令可以设置日期和时间,例如:"date 2021-06-01"设置日期为2021年6月1日;"time 10:00"设置时间为上午10点。
- 使用控制面板设置服务器时间:在控制面板中选择"Clock and Region"(时钟和区域),然后点击"Date and Time"(日期和时间),在"Date and Time"选项卡中可以手动设置日期和时间。
-
Linux操作系统:
- 使用date命令设置服务器时间:在命令行终端中输入"date"命令可以查看当前日期和时间,输入"date -s [日期时间]"命令可以设置日期和时间,例如:"date -s '2021-06-01 10:00:00'"设置日期时间为2021年6月1日上午10点。
- 使用timedatectl命令设置服务器时间:在命令行终端中输入"timedatectl set-time [日期时间]"命令可以设置日期和时间,例如:"timedatectl set-time '2021-06-01 10:00:00'"设置日期时间为2021年6月1日上午10点。
-
macOS操作系统:
- 使用系统偏好设置设置服务器时间:点击苹果菜单,选择"系统偏好设置",然后选择"日期与时间",在"日期和时间"选项卡中可以手动设置日期和时间。
总之,根据不同的操作系统,可以使用不同的命令或操作界面来设置服务器时间。需要根据具体情况选择适合的方法进行时间设置。
1年前 -
-
在Linux系统中,可以使用以下命令来设置服务器的时间:
-
date命令
在终端中输入date命令,即可显示当前系统的日期和时间。要更改系统时间,可以使用以下格式的命令:date -s "YYYY-MM-DD HH:MM:SS"其中,YYYY表示年份,MM表示月份,DD表示日期,HH表示小时,MM表示分钟,SS表示秒钟。例如,要将系统时间设置为2022年1月1日12:00:00,可以使用以下命令:
date -s "2022-01-01 12:00:00" -
timedatectl命令
timedatectl是一个用于管理系统时间和日期的工具。使用该命令,可以设置服务器的时间、时区和时间同步服务。timedatectl set-time "YYYY-MM-DD HH:MM:SS"与date命令类似,"YYYY-MM-DD HH:MM:SS"表示要设置的日期和时间。
-
hwclock命令
hwclock命令用于读取或设置硬件时钟的时间。硬件时钟通常是存储在计算机主板上的实时时钟,用于在系统启动时获取初始的系统时间。hwclock --set --date="YYYY-MM-DD HH:MM:SS"这将设置硬件时钟的日期和时间为指定的值。
-
NTP服务
NTP(Network Time Protocol)是一种用于同步计算机时钟的网络协议。在服务器上安装和配置NTP服务可以自动同步服务器的时间。可以通过以下步骤进行设置:- 安装NTP服务
sudo apt-get install ntp- 配置NTP服务器
sudo vi /etc/ntp.conf打开配置文件后,可以添加、修改NTP服务器的配置。最常见的是添加一行类似于以下内容的配置:
server ntp.example.com- 启动NTP服务
sudo systemctl start ntp以上是在Ubuntu或Debian系统上安装和配置NTP服务的示例,其他Linux发行版可能会有所不同。
-
自动更新时间
除了手动设置时间外,还可以使用crontab定时任务来自动设置服务器的时间。可以创建一个shell脚本,其中包含要运行的日期和时间设置命令,并将其添加到crontab文件中。以下是一个示例脚本:#!/bin/bash date -s "2022-01-01 12:00:00"将脚本保存为set_time.sh,并添加到crontab中:
crontab -e添加以下行来设置每天的12点运行脚本:
0 12 * * * /path/to/set_time.sh保存并退出crontab文件,脚本将在每天的12点自动运行,并设置服务器的时间。
以上是一些常见的用于设置服务器时间的命令和方法。根据实际需求选择合适的方法来设置服务器的时间。
1年前 -
-
设置服务器时间的命令取决于服务器的操作系统和版本。下面列举了几个常见的操作系统以及对应的设置服务器时间的命令:
-
Windows Server:
- 手动设置时间:在任务栏的右下角点击日期和时间,选择“更改日期和时间设置”,然后点击“更改日期和时间”,进行手动设置。
- 使用命令行设置时间:在命令提示符窗口中,输入以下命令并按回车执行:
date [日期] time [时间]
-
Linux:
- 设置日期时间:在终端中以root身份执行以下命令:
date -s "YYYY-MM-DD HH:MM:SS"其中,YYYY-MM-DD是日期,HH:MM:SS是时间。
- 同步时间服务器:在终端中以root身份执行以下命令:
ntpdate time.nist.gov或者
ntpdate -u time.nist.gov
- 设置日期时间:在终端中以root身份执行以下命令:
-
macOS Server:
- 手动设置时间:点击系统偏好设置,选择日期与时间。在日期和时间面板上点击锁图标,输入管理员凭证,然后点击“日期和时间”选项卡,手动设置日期和时间。
- 使用命令行设置时间:在终端中输入以下命令并按回车执行:
sudo date [mmddhhmmYYYY]其中,mm表示月份,dd表示日期,hh表示小时,mm表示分钟,YYYY表示年份。
以上是常见的设置服务器时间的命令,注意根据服务器的操作系统和版本选择适合的命令进行设置。在执行这些命令之前,建议先备份服务器的时间设置以便出错时可以恢复。
1年前 -